Why High-Quality Food Packaging Is Essential for Freshness

High-quality food packaging serves a vital role in preserving freshness. It serves as the first line of defense against environmental factors that can compromise the quality of food products. Effective packaging materials create a barrier to moisture, oxygen, and light, which are key elements that accelerate spoilage. By employing superior packaging solutions, manufacturers can increase the shelf life of perishable products, making certain that consumers get items that are not only safe to consume but also maintain their desired flavor and texture.

Additionally, well-designed packaging can enable optimal storage conditions, additionally maintaining freshness. For example, vacuum-sealed packages can decrease air exposure, while modified atmosphere packaging can adjust gas concentrations inside the container. Ultimately, investing in quality food packaging is crucial for preserving the integrity of food products from production to consumption, ultimately serving both producers and consumers alike.

Food Packaging: Ensuring Safety and Compliance

Maintaining safety and regulatory compliance in food packaging is essential for preserving public health and maintaining industry standards. Food packaging needs to comply with rigorous standards set by authorities such as the FDA to mitigate risks related to food spoilage or contamination. This involves using materials that are safe for food contact, as well as providing appropriate product labeling that informs consumers about key ingredients and allergen information.

Manufacturers must carry out thorough evaluations to certify that packaging materials do not leach harmful substances into food products. Furthermore, adhering to hygiene requirements throughout the packaging procedure is essential to eliminate the risk of cross-contamination. Periodic reviews and inspections assist in preserving these standards, strengthening public trust in the quality of food products.

In the end, compliance with safety regulations not only protects public health but also strengthens brand reputation, motivating consumers to select products that emphasize quality and adherence. This commitment is essential for a sustainable food supply chain.

Innovative Packaging Materials

A significant portion of the food manufactured worldwide is wasted due to ineffective packaging approaches. Revolutionary packaging materials are emerging as an vital component in resolving this challenge. Eco-friendly films and biodegradable packaging are being developed to minimize environmental effects while preserving food quality. Reactive packaging solutions, which incorporates elements that remove excess moisture or oxygen, helps extend shelf life and reduces deterioration. Additionally, advanced sensing materials that display color shifts or visual signals about freshness are gaining traction. These advancements not only extend the lifespan of products but also reduce wasted food, contributing to more sustainable consumption patterns. As the food production sector evolves, incorporating these advanced materials will be essential in creating effective barriers against waste and making certain food is delivered to consumers in optimal condition.

Smart Design Solutions

Smart design solutions play an essential role in decreasing food waste by improving packaging efficiency and practicality. Well-designed packaging can increase shelf life through features such as resealable closures and vacuum sealing, which preserve freshness and prevent spoilage. Furthermore, transparent materials allow consumers to assess product quality visually, fostering informed purchasing decisions. Through the integration of portion control features, manufacturers can also minimize excess food preparation, aligning servings with consumer needs. Beyond that, intelligent labeling that precisely communicates expiration dates and storage guidelines strengthens buyer comprehension, decreasing the likelihood of premature disposal. Ultimately, advanced packaging designs not only preserve food but also support conscious consumption, contributing greatly to sustainable practices in the food industry.

What Certifications Are Available for Sustainable Food Packaging?

Yes, various certifications exist for eco-friendly food packaging, including FSC (Forest Stewardship Council), Cradle to Cradle, and compostability certifications. Such certifications verify sustainable practices, ensuring packaging materials meet sustainability standards throughout their lifecycle.
